I want to be available to you. Let me know if there is anything I can do to help your child succeed. I do not know a lick of French. . . How can I possibly help my child with their work? Encourage your child to review their notes for about ten minutes each night. Let them pronounce the French words for you. Let them teach you a few words and what they mean. Research shows that teaching words and concepts to others is a great way to learn. Most importantly, for my classes and for all classes, one of the best things you can do to help your child is to help them stay organized!!! Ask them to show you their notes for the day. If they cannot find their notes, they need to be more organized. Make sure that they have a seperate folder for each subject. If they have one large binder, notes should be divided into different subject areas using dividers. Make sure that they have a bag or specific place to put writing utensils. Organization is a major part of success in the high school environment.
